News
New Architecture and Services Enable Faster Access to More Information
01/19
Overview
Recent architecture improvements provide faster access to RCSB.org content with improved page load times. Some of the more prominent changes are summarized below.
- New URL structure
- Structure Summary Page (SSP)
- 3D View
- PDB Statistics
- New REST services
Simplified URL Structure
RCSB PDB is moving to a new microservice-based architecture to better scale our services to accommodate growth and user demand, and to increase the speed at which we can deploy new services. In parallel, we are streamlining our URLs for easy access and sharing. The previous URL structure is still fully supported (for the time being) and will automatically redirect to the new URLs. Examples are below
Old URL Structure
- Home Page https://www.rcsb.org/pdb/home/home.do
- SSP https://www.rcsb.org/pdb/explore/explore.do?structureId=4dkl
- 3D View http://www.rcsb.org/pdb/ngl/ngl.do?pdbid=4dkl&bionumber=1
- Careers https://www.rcsb.org/pdb/static.do?p=general_information/about_pdb/contact/job_listings.html
New URL Structure
- Home Page https://www.rcsb.org/
- SSP https://www.rcsb.org/structure/4dkl
- 3D View https://www.rcsb.org/3d-view/4dkl/1
- Careers https://www.rcsb.org/pages/jobs
Changes to the Structure Summary Page (SSP)
Top-level SSP pages utilize the new microservice architecture to enable fast access to:
The 3D View now offers options for macromolecular-ligand interactions and X-ray electron density maps using NGL. Ligand interaction viewing options include hydrogen bonds, hydrophobic contacts, halogen bonds, pi interactions, and metal interactions. A 3D View User Guide is available.
PDB Statistics
Improved display of PDB statistics are available; including the distribution of structures released per year, and refinement software used.
REST Services
Our new REST services are used internally to support these new features at RCSB.org. They are also available for public use. If you are interested in using these REST services or want to request a service, please reach via the Contact Us button.